Common Questions People Have About Cash or Trade? The Risky Deal That Could Change Your Life
How safe is trading cash for services or goods?
While no exchange carries zero risk, verified platforms reduce exposure by offering escrow, dispute resolution, and transparent terms. Users should assess counterparties carefully and document every agreement.
Can cash or trade actually improve my financial position?
When used wisely, this approach unlocks new liquidity, defers paid obligations, or turns idle assets into usable value—potentially freeing up cash flow and supporting short-term stability.

Is this unrestricted or limited by regulation?
Exchanges vary: cash-for-goods must comply with anti-fraud and consumer protection laws, while crypto-based trades face evolving SEC and FinCEN scrutiny. Full compliance depends on platform legitimacy and jurisdiction.
Opportunities and Considerations: Pros, Cons, and Realistic Expectations
Advantages:
- Greater liquidity with fewer transaction fees
- Access to goods and services not available through traditional markets
- Opportunity to monetize unused assets or digital holdings
- Flexibility to match offers with personal timing and needs
Challenges:
- Risk of miscommunication or unreliable partners
- Market volatility in asset-backed trades
- Regulatory visibility and compliance requirements
- No instant cash—delivery, valuation, and settlement take time
In the US, consumer awareness is rising, but caution remains critical. This trade isn’t a guaranteed shortcut to wealth—it’s a structured option demanding clarity, planning, and trust.
